Problème photo avec le HTML

yourt -  
 yourt -
Bonjour,
Je découvre actuellement l'écriture HTML, malheureusement je reste bloqué à un endroit : j'espère que quelqu'un pourra m'aider.
Je voudrai mettre une photo en HTML, mais dès que j'ouvre la page internet il me met un petit carré avec une page déchirée. pourtant lorsque j'écris en HTML je mets : <IMG SRC= (<=suivi de l'adresse que je prend en découpé collé) terminé par .JPEG>

D'où vient le problème ? cela vient de la photo ? ou de ma façon d'écrire ?

merci d'avance pour vos réponses

A voir également:

5 réponses

jojo673 Messages postés 210 Date d'inscription   Statut Membre Dernière intervention   44
 
Pour mettre une image il faut utiliser :
<img src="repertoire/images.jpg" alt="texte qui remplace l'image" />
Montrez nous la ligne complète pour voir quel est l'erreur.
0
yourt
 
Voici ce que j'ai mis

<IMG SRC=C:\Users\Marc\Desktop\HTML\Saisons\Hiver.JPG>
0
yourt
 
Que voulez-vous dire par alt="texte qui remplace l'image" />
0
visibility:hidden Messages postés 249 Date d'inscription   Statut Membre Dernière intervention   47
 
@yourt : c'est le chemin de l'image hébergée qu'il faut mettre, pas sur ton poste local... comment tu veux que ton site vienne la chercher :(
0
patrick7338 Messages postés 51 Date d'inscription   Statut Membre Dernière intervention   6
 
bonjour

tout dépend ou est située l' image.

<img src="http://imageshac.us/monimage23659874589.jpg" width="" height=""
alt="" /> si l' image est quelque part sur le net

<img src="fichier_images/monimage.jpg" width="" height="" alt="" />
si elle est sur ton P.C
attention à l' extension; JPG et jpg ce n' est pas pareil.
Html est sensible à la casse.
0
yourt
 
Pour le moment j'essaye avec les images sur mon disque dure.
"width"ou "height" faut les mettre où exactement ?
Oui j'imagine que le HTML est très sensible : mon problème est bien là, justement j'aurais peut-être dû l'écrire JPG en minuscule ?

Merci encore à vous deux
0
patrick7338 Messages postés 51 Date d'inscription   Statut Membre Dernière intervention   6
 
le plus simple est de creer un fichier principal qui contient tes pages html, css...
dedans tu cree un deuxieme fichier (mes_images) et tu y transfere tes images.

ainsi le lien devient:
<img src="mes_images/image.jpeg" width="90" height="65" alt="blablabla" />

width c' est la longueur de l' image en pixel. height c' est sa hauteur.

alt est un commentaire qui s' affiche en remplacement de l' image, si elle n' est pas disponible. c' est aussi le texte qui sera lu par un navigateur non graphique.
si il n' est pas renseigné (alt="") le navigateur l' interprete comme une image de decoration, et la chargera apres les images importantes.

width et height permettent au navigateur de faire la mise en page sans attendre
que l' image soit chargee.

pour connaitre l' extension de l' image: click droit puis proprietes -> type du fichier
le type est entre parentheses. ex: Image JPEG (.jpg)
il faut ecrire: nom_de_l_image.jpg

P.S il faut remplacer les \ par /
les backslashs \ sont propre à Microsoft, et le navigateur ne peux pas comprendre l' adresse. même Internet Explorer.
0
yourt
 
Merci patrick7338, j'espère ne plus t'embêter longtemps encore.

Donc la nouvelle adresse donne ceci : <img src="mes_images/image.jpeg" width="90" height="65" alt="nom_de_l_image_hiver.jpg " />
Néanmoins, lorsque j'ouvre la page HTML, j'ai un petit rectangle avec à l'intérieur la page en haut à droite déchirée, et dans le rectangle il y a la fin de l'adresse HTML de noté.

Je pense que je dois me tromper dans la fin de l'adresse, par rapport à propriété.

Voici ce qui y a écris dans propriété : hiver
Type du fichier : Image JPEG (.jpg)
S'ouvre avec : Visionneuse de photos Windows
........
alors où est mon problème ?
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
faboons Messages postés 275 Date d'inscription   Statut Membre Dernière intervention   50
 
Salut,

Je ne te conseille pas les attributs width et height.
Ils vont modifier la taille de ton image "artificiellement" et l'écraser ou l'étendre.
Si la taille est déjà la bonne par contre c'est bon.

Il faut modifier la taille de l'image à ta convenance avant de la placer dans le html avec un logiciel comme thegimp ou paint.net qui sont gratuits.

L'attribut alt est utile pour indexer les images, c'est un texte qui s'affiche lorsque l'image a un problème d'affichage.
Il favorise aussi l'accessibilité pour les personne handicapées.

@+.
Fab.

L'important n'est pas de convaincre, mais de donner à réfléchir.
0
scid
 
Salut,
Il vaut mieux mettre directement le chemin en relatif plutôt qu'en absolu. Cela éviteras les problèmes à l'exportation sur le serveur web. L'exemple de Patrick7338 est donc le bon(avec un dossier image à la racine du site pour pas mélanger).
Plus d'info sur l'adressage absolu et relatif ici:

http://www.php-astux.info/chemins-relatif-absolu.php
0
yourt
 
faboons, merci de me répondre.
J'ai déjà pu lire sur la toile que des internautes utilisaient cette technique, et je serai ravi de l'apprendre. Néanmoins, pour le néophyte que je suis, cela me paraît un peu compliqué pour le moment et, width & height paraissent plus simple
0